sin(angle) = Opposite leg / Hypotenuse
sin(45) = Opposite leg / 16
Opposite Leg = 16 x sin(45)
Opposite leg = 16 x SQRT(2)/2
Opposite leg = 8SQRT(2)
The answer is B.
